Werd has finally cracked the stakes winner title after holding off Power Princess in the Listed WATC Stakes (1100m) on the weekend in the slick time of 1.03.72.
He jumped in his usual brilliant style, but Campbell McCallum grabbed hold and let the speedy Latoria take up the running with Noname City pressuring to her outside.
Those two set a furious pace and on the corner, Werd was off the bit trying to keep up. In the straight, his turn of foot kicked in and he hit the front while Power Princess and All Friared Up attempted to run him down.
Without having led and done all of the work, Werd had enough in the tank to hold off the challengers, something he has found it difficult to do in this class of event.
We had to endure the cruelest of delays while the second palcegetter, Paul Harvey on Power Princess, fired in an protest based on interference alleged to have happened at the 900m mark. It was a harrowing time for connections who had already waited an eternity for their first taste of black type success.
The protest was dismissed, much to all of our delight.
Having added another dimension to his racing arsenal, Werd will now go to the 1200m Listed Miss Andretti Stakes on March 31 at Ascot.
